在Windows操作系统中,右键菜单是一个非常实用的功能,它允许用户快速访问常用的程序或命令。今天,我们就来详细解析如何设置一个右键菜单项,使得用户可以一键以管理员权限打开cmd指令。
准备工作
在开始之前,请确保您已经打开了Windows的“管理员”账户,因为我们需要以管理员权限来修改注册表。
步骤一:创建一个批处理文件
首先,我们需要创建一个批处理文件,这个文件将包含打开cmd指令的命令,并且以管理员权限运行。
- 打开记事本或任何文本编辑器。
- 输入以下代码:
@echo off
start /wait cmd /c powershell -NoProfile -ExecutionPolicy Bypass -Command "Start-Process cmd -Verb runas"
exit
这段代码的作用是使用PowerShell启动一个以管理员权限运行的cmd窗口。
- 保存文件,文件名可以命名为
OpenCmdAsAdmin.bat,并确保保存类型为“所有文件”。 - 将批处理文件保存到您想要的位置,例如桌面。
步骤二:创建右键菜单项
接下来,我们需要在注册表中添加一个条目,以便在右键菜单中创建一个新的选项。
- 按下
Win + R打开“运行”对话框。 - 输入
regedit并按下回车键打开注册表编辑器。 - 在注册表编辑器中,导航到以下路径:
HKEY_CLASSES_ROOT\Directory\Background\shell
- 右键点击“shell”,选择“新建” -> “键”。
- 将新创建的键重命名为
OpenCmdAsAdmin。
步骤三:添加命令行
现在我们需要在 OpenCmdAsAdmin 下创建一个字符串值,用来指定右键菜单项的显示名称。
- 在
OpenCmdAsAdmin下,右键点击空白处,选择“新建” -> “字符串值”。 - 将新创建的字符串值重命名为
Command。 - 双击
Command,在“数值数据”框中输入以下路径:
%USERPROFILE%\Desktop\OpenCmdAsAdmin.bat
确保将 %USERPROFILE%\Desktop\OpenCmdAsAdmin.bat 替换为您保存批处理文件的路径。
步骤四:完成设置
现在,当您在文件或文件夹上右键点击时,应该会看到一个名为“OpenCmdAsAdmin”的新选项。选择这个选项,就会以管理员权限打开cmd窗口。
注意事项
- 修改注册表可能会对系统稳定性产生影响,请谨慎操作。
- 如果您不熟悉注册表编辑,建议在修改前备份注册表。
- 在完成设置后,如果需要删除这个右键菜单项,可以回到注册表编辑器,删除
HKEY_CLASSES_ROOT\Directory\Background\shell\OpenCmdAsAdmin下的所有条目。
通过以上步骤,您就可以轻松地设置一个右键菜单项,实现一键以管理员权限打开cmd指令了。
